Bach - Violin Concertos

Concerto for Two Violins in D minor, BWV1043 Catherine Mackintosh and Elizabeth Wallfisch (violins)
Violin Concertos Nos. 1 in A minor, BWV1041; 2 in E major, BWV1042 Catherine Mackintosh (violin)
Concerto for Oboe & Violin in C minor, BWV1060 Reconstructed from the Concerto in C minor for two harpsichords, BWV 1060 Elizabeth Wallfisch (violin) & Paul Goodwin (oboe)
The King’s Consort/Robert King


Hyperion Helios - CDH55347

It is good to have this fine disc in the catalogue as a bargain re-issue. It features two of our best loved baroque violinists, long term friends and colleagues, with Robert King and his Consort, who together over the years have given great pleasure in London and on tour.

The interpretations combine period correctness with expressive intensity. Paul Goodwin adds piquant colour in the reconstructed C minor concerto. King's notes are exemplary, and Hyperion has chosen an intriguing illustration from London's Wallace Collection (close by Wigmore Hall) by Van Loo "whose critical fortune has plummeted, although his ability remains admirable" - worth following up.

These accounts of the Bach concertos were universally acclaimed; you can sample them at http://www.hyperion-records.co.uk/al.asp?al=CDH55347 and will need no further persuasion.
